Basic Bath remodels:
You probably wont be hiring an architect to do plans, so it is helpful if you sketch a basic floor-plan so we can help you co-ordinate your layout. It is also helpful to meet with your plumbing contractor to establish any mechanical boundaries/constraints before visiting us.
Choosing kitchen sinks:
You will need to know the size of the sink-base cabinet. You will also need to know your countertop material and the width of your back-splash.
